Mumbai University offers admission to the UG, PG and PhD programs. The university is known for Commerce, Arts and Science. The university also offers education via distance learning from its Institute of Distance and Open Learning (IDOL, Mumbai University). Admissions are done based on Merit and the entrance tests conducted by their affiliated colleges.

  • Mumbai University offers B.Com, BMS and BAF as their popular courses.
  • For the UG and PG courses, Admissions are processed online through the University’s Centralised Admission Portal, based on merit or entrance exam scores.
  • To get admission in UG and PG courses, most of the Affiliated colleges conducted their own entrance exams, such as XET, HR Aptitude Test, Mithibai Entrance Aptitude Test, etc.
  • For admission in the B.Tech program, students must appear for the MH-CET or JEE Main.

Mumbai University B.Com Admission

Mumbai University's most popular courses include B.Com in its affiliated colleges. The admission in B.Com is done based on Merit, conducted through the Mumbai University Centralised Admission Portal. To get admission in B.Com, candidates must have passed 10+2 with 50% marks.

Mumbai University B.Com Admission Process

Here are the Details of Mumbai University B.Com Admission Process in a tabular format.

Stage Process Details
Online Registration Visit the official portal @mum.digitaluniversity.ac and complete the pre-admission online registration.
College Application Form Fill out the individual college admission form for the preferred affiliated college offering B.Com.
Document Upload Upload scanned copies of the required documents, such as your 10+2 mark sheet, ID proof, and a passport-size photograph.
Merit List & Selection Admission is merit-based. Check the college merit lists released online to see if you’re shortlisted.
Admission Confirmation Visit the college (online/offline) to verify documents and confirm admission.
Fee Payment Pay the admission and course fees online through the college portal to finalise your seat.

Key Highlights

  • No Centralised Exams for UG course
  • College have their own entrance exams, in addition to the state and national level exams
  • No entrance exam required to get admission in B.Com, BA or any Hons Subject.
  • Admissions are done based on Merit
  • The Affiliated colleges call for the subject selection based on merit
  • For Medical Courses, the entrance exams are required
  • For engineering courses, Candidates must have to appear for MHT-CET or JEE Main exams.
  • For Law Courses, MHT-CET for Law, mandatory for 3 and 5-year degrees.
  • For BMS, BBA, BCA, and BBM, MHT-CET is mandatory for all.
  • Jai Hind College, admission based on 50% 12th based and 50% JHCCEE, which is their own entrance exam.
  • Xavier's College: 40% weightage 12th based, 60% on XET

Mumbai University Admission Process

Here is the admission process of Mumbai University in a tabulated format:

Process Details / Notes
Online Registration Visit the official Mumbai University website or the Samarth e-Gov portal and complete the pre-admission online registration.
Form Submission Fill out and submit the college-specific admission form on the college’s website. Attach the required documents and pay the application fee.
Document Verification Upload or submit original documents for verification as per college instructions (10th, 12th mark sheets, ID proof, etc.).
Merit List Declaration Colleges release merit lists based on cut-off marks and eligibility criteria.
Fee Payment & Admission Confirmation Pay the course fees online/offline and confirm your admission within the given deadline.
Final Enrollment Once the admission is confirmed, collect the admission receipt and complete enrollment formalities at the college.

Note:- Students from boards/universities other than the Maharashtra State Board/Mumbai University must apply for a Provisional Eligibility Certificate.

Question: How does the merit list get prepared?

Ans. The merit list is curated from a variety of sources at Mumbai University, but it is mainly based on the marks obtained in the qualifying examination, like Class 12 for graduation courses or graduation marks for Postgraduate programs. Each college and each course will set its own cut-off percentage based on the total applications received. This information will then be completely assigned to the merit list and uploaded onto the university's admission site, but also each college will put up a merit list on their individual sites. Students can check this site and merit listings to determine their options as they move through the admission process.

Admission was on 12th score as cut-off for Maharashtra board students was 78% and for other boards if from Maharashtra it was 84%. For OMS (Outside Maharashtra) it was 88%. So I was in that 84 % bracket and made it just by edge as mine was 86%. Nearly 300 seats and over 30k students compete for that.
